#4400de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4400de is composed of 26.7% red, 0% green and 87.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.4% cyan, 100%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.9% black. It has a hue angle of 258.4 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 43.5%. #4400de color hex could be obtained by blending #8800ff with #0000bd.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

#4400de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4400de has RGB values of R:68, G:0, B:222 and CMYK values of C:0.69, M:1, Y:0,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 4456670.

Shades and Tints of #4400de
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020006 is the darkest color, while #f6f2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#4400de
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6c6678 is the less saturated color, while #4400de is the most saturated one.
